Postby King Kev » Sun Mar 30, 2014 3:15 pm

Yaya often only plays 15-20 minutes of a game.
Sometimes it's more (utd on Tuesday) sometimes it's less (yesterday) but I reckon the average is no more than 20 minutes per game.

When he does play he is phenomenal, which is why he features heavily in edited highlights of matches. If you only get to see the highlights it looks like he has been brilliant throughout the entire match, sadly this is actually rarely the case.

We are lucky to have the likes of Fernandinho, Silva and Nasri to pick up the slack during Yaya's downtime, however we can get found out against some of the better teams.

Postby Benjay » Mon Mar 31, 2014 7:31 am

Is this debate for real? I am simply amazed. Lets just say that Yaya gets injured this week and is ruled out for the run in. Would we be bothered? Of course we would. Ok he has periods when he ambles in and out of action but he is a Colossius in the midfield. He changes games at the drop of a hat. We were going nowhere in the League Cup final until he scored. We should play him more upfront where defences would hate to see so much of him but he glues the midfield together with Ferdy. Along with Kompany he is our most important player. We can cope without Sergio (although it would be nice to have him back) but a long spell of injury or suspension for Yaya or Vinnie - I dont know about you - has me concerned. Yes there are days that Yaya looks disinterested - a lot of that is his body language - but he covers a lot of ground and his passes total must be one of the highest in the league. The guy must be knackered for the shifts he puts in...
